Why Choose Aluminum Windows?
Aluminum windows are renowned for a number of crucial attributes that make them a competitive choice for window replacement:
Benefits of Aluminum Windows
Resilience and Longevity: Aluminum is extremely resistant to weather aspects, including wind, rain, and hail. It does not warp, fracture, or broaden, adding to a long life-span.
Low Maintenance: Unlike wood, aluminum frames do not require routine painting or sealing. A basic periodic cleaning is typically adequate to maintain their look.
Energy Efficiency: While aluminum is a conductor of heat, contemporary aluminum windows typically include thermal breaks that enhance insulation. This can significantly decrease heating and cooling expenses.
Visual Versatility: Aluminum windows come in a variety of surfaces and colors, permitting property owners to match their windows with the architectural style of their home flawlessly.
Boosted Security: The strength of aluminum makes it difficult to burglarize, offering an extra layer of security compared to other materials.

Window Style and Design: Choose the window style that matches the character of your home. Alternatives include sash, sliding, double-hung, awning, and repaired windows.
Budget plan: Determine your budget plan for the task. While aluminum windows provide long-lasting savings, the initial financial investment can differ.
Installation Complexity: Replacing windows can be a complicated task. Decide whether you will work with experts or attempt a DIY technique.
Local Climate: Evaluate your local climate condition. Aluminum windows with thermal breaks are especially useful in extreme climates.
Allowing Regulations: Check with local authorities about building codes and necessary authorizations for window replacements to guarantee compliance.

Measuring the Existing Windows: Measure the width and height of the present windows, making sure precise dimensions for the new systems.
Picking New Windows: Research and select aluminum windows that satisfy your visual requirements and energy efficiency objectives.
Preparing the Area: Clear the work area by removing furnishings or ornamental items. Ensure security protocols remain in place.
Removing Old Windows: Carefully detach the existing windows, being cautious not to damage surrounding walls or structures.
Installing New Windows: Follow manufacturer standards for installation, guaranteeing that the new windows are level and secure.
Sealing and Insulating: Apply appropriate insulation materials around the window frame to avoid air or water leakages.
Finishing Touches: Trim the area around the new windows for a sleek appearance, and restore the work area to its initial state.

Proper upkeep ensures the longevity and performance of aluminum windows. Here are some upkeep ideas:
Regular Cleaning: Use mild soapy water and a soft fabric to tidy frames regularly. The length of time do aluminum windows last?
Aluminum windows can last for 20-30 years or more, depending on their quality and maintenance.
2. Are aluminum windows energy-efficient?
Modern aluminum windows are developed with thermal breaks that boost their energy-efficiency capabilities, assisting to manage indoor temperature levels.
3. Can I set up aluminum windows myself?
While it is possible to set up aluminum windows as a DIY project, hiring a professional is recommended for accuracy and warranty purposes.
4. How much do aluminum windows cost?
The cost differs commonly based upon size, type, and brand, usually varying from ₤ 150 to ₤ 1,500 per window.
